Why are we making this change?

In June 2023, the Australian Government announced the decision to phase out the use of cheques in Australia by 2030. Cheque use has been rapidly declining over the last 10 years*. The provider People’s Choice used to facilitate member cheque facilities notified us that they were withdrawing this service in May 2024.

This decision aimed to modernise banking operations, enhance security measures, and simplify financial transactions for all.

 

Change Timeline

People’s Choice adopted a phased approach to the wind up of member chequing services, with the following activities having been scheduled.

  1. From 1 August 2023, no new cheque accounts able to be opened, and automatic renewals of cheque books ceased - Existing cheque facilities continued - Replacement cheque books able to be ordered via NCC or Branch
  2. From 7 March 2024, no new cheque books can be ordered - Existing cheque books can be retained and cheques issued and presented
  3. From 24 May 2024, all member cheques are cancelled - cheques written from a People’s Choice cheque book are unable to be presented for payment.

FAQs

  • Why did People’s Choice stop cheques in 2024 when the Government isn’t doing so until 2030?

    Cheque use has been declining rapidly over the last 10 years* with digital payment methods increasing as the faster payment alternative. The service partner that provided member chequing facilities to People’s Choice made the decision to withdraw this service in May 2024.

    This decision aimed to modernise banking operations, enhance security measures, and simplify financial transactions for all.

  • How were members advised?

    All members associated with an account that had a cheque book attached were notified of this change from 23 Jan 2024.

  • Can I still use my existing cheque books?

    Cheques written from existing People’s Choice cheque books can no longer be presented.
